Acrolepiopsis incertella
Species of moth From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Remove ads
Acrolepiopsis incertella is a moth of the family Acrolepiidae. It is found in the eastern half of North America, from southern Ontario to Florida and Mississippi in the south and to Illinois and Michigan in the west.[1]
The length of the forewings 4.3–6 mm.
